By between 1300 and 1340 the oud experienced turn into modified ample by Europeans to become another and distinctive instrument, the medieval lute. By slightly soon after c. 1400, western lutes had been increasingly fretted and by 1481 the medieval lute experienced produced into the renaissance lute, The key western instrument of the period of time, by then mirroring the significance of the oud in the east.

The oldest pictorial document of a brief-necked lute-type vīnā dates from round the 1st to third centuries Advertisement.[forty four] The website of origin with the oud seems to be Central Asia.
One concept would be that the oud originated in the Persian instrument named a barbat (Persian: بربت ) or barbud, a lute indicated by Marcel-Dubois to be of Central Asian origin. The earliest pictorial picture with the barbat dates back for the 1st century BC from historical northern Bactria and is particularly the oldest proof of your existence from the barbat.

Arabian ouds are Commonly much larger than their Turkish and Persian counterparts, developing a fuller, further audio, whereas the sound of your Turkish oud is a lot more taut and shrill, not minimum because the Turkish oud is usually (and partly) tuned one full action increased compared to Arabian.[54] Turkish ouds tend to be more evenly created than Arabian with the unfinished seem board, decreased string action and with string classes positioned closer alongside one another.

Once the Umayyads conquered Hispania in 711, they brought their ud alongside. An oud is depicted as currently being performed by a seated musician[33] in Qasr Amra with the Umayyad dynasty, on the list of earliest depictions from the instrument as played in early Islamic historical past.
